Bzon Tablet is used in the treatment of inflammatory and allergic conditions. The detailed uses of Bzon Tablet are as follows:
Bzon Tablet is a steroid that is used to treat swelling, redness, heat and tenderness in the body. Thus, it is used to improve different con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, asthma, severe allergic reactions, systemic lupus erythematosus (SLS) and polyarteritis nodosa (swollen arteries), inflammatory conditions of the skin, heart, kidney (like minimal change nephrotic syndrome or acute interstitial nephritis) and bowels (like ulcerative colitis-inflammation in the digestive tract or Crohn’s disease), certain conditions of the blood, some connective tissues diseases and some types of cancer such as malignant lymphoma. Betamethasone soluble tablets may be used as a mouthwash to treat conditions such as oral lichen planus (white, lacy patches, or open sores) and mouth ulcers. It helps to reduce pain and inflammation in the mouth and speeds up the healing process.

Bzon Tablet is used to reduce inflammation (swelling, redness, heat, and tenderness) in the body.
Bzon Tablet contains Betamethasone, a steroid that acts inside skin cells to inhibit the release of certain chemical messengers in the body that cause redness, itching, and swelling. When the skin reacts to allergens, such chemicals are naturally released.
Bzon Tablet may cause mental problems, especially if taken in high doses. However, inform your doctor immediately if you notice mood changes or have depression and suicidal thoughts while taking Bzon Tablet .
A blue steroid card consists of patients' instructions and provides information to healthcare providers regarding the details of prescribed steroids. It is given to patients using Bzon Tablet for more than 3 weeks. The patient is advised to carry a steroid card always and show it to the nurse, midwife, doctor, dentist or anyone who treats them.
Bzon Tablet may increase the risk of infections as it may weaken the immune system. Therefore, it is advised to stay away from people having chickenpox, measles or shingles as they can affect severely while taking Bzon Tablet .
If you have diabetes, you are recommended to discuss it with your doctor before taking Bzon Tablet as it may increase blood sugar levels.

Bzon Tablet may cause nausea, indigestion, irregular periods, weight gain, or increased susceptibility to infection. Most of these side effects of Bzon Tablet do not require medical attention and gradually resolve over time. However, if the side effects persist or worsen, please consult your doctor.
Yes, it is safe to use Bzon Tablet if prescribed by the doctor.
Bzon Tablet does not cause hair loss. Rather, on long-term use it may cause body hair growth, particularly in females.
Yes, Bzon Tablet may cause weight gain as a side effect. Maintain proper weight by eating healthy food and exercising regularly.
No, Bzon Tablet is not an over-the-counter medicine. It should be taken only when prescribed by the doctor.
If you miss a dose of Bzon Tablet , take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for the sc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and take the next dose at the scheduled time.
